Over half of 8,204 virus infected policemen recover

Policemen check cars and motorbikes amid coronavirus outbreak in DhakaUNB file photo

A total of 4,541 policemen among 8,204 made full recovery from coronavirus as of Wednesday morning, reports UNB.

“Among the total patients, 2,003 policemen are attached to Dhaka Metropolitan Police (DMP),” said sources at the police headquarters.

Most of the policemen, who recovered earlier, have joined their respective duty stations.

Members of Bangladesh police, armed forces, and RAB, along with other agencies have been jointly working to ensure social distancing across the country amid the coronavirus pandemic.

Earlier on Monday, 53 policemen were released from Rajarbagh Central Police Hospital (CPH).

The sources said that 27 policemen and one civilian member of the law enforcement agency died of COVID-19 till date.

Bangladesh has so far reported 98,489 coronavirus cases and 1,305 deaths.

In a bid to contain the outbreak, the government has introduced red zone and put them under strict lockdown across the country.

Seventeen areas under Dhaka North City Corporation (DNCC), 28 areas under Dhaka South City Corporation (DSCC), 11 areas in Chattogram, sadar, Rupganj and Araihazar upazilas of Narayanganj, Narsingdi model and Madhabdi thanas, Palash upazila in Narsingdi and all upazilas of Gazipur will be declared as red zones, according to UNB.
